Leadership Review Briefing — Second-Source Supplier Search
Prepared for the Board of Veltrane Industries

Procurement has evaluated four candidate suppliers for the Orliss valve assembly to reduce dependence on our sole source in Kestrel Bay. Two candidates passed initial quality audits; tooling trials begin next month. Cost deltas range from neutral to +4%, offset by improved lead times. One strategic consideration is recorded below for board eyes only.

board note of bawep-tajef: Queniusek Systems plans to raise the Quenvan list price by 53.1 percent in March. The pricing group signed off on a budget of $176.4 million for Project Drueth. The renewal with Casionix Partners closes at $142.5 million a year, 8.3 percent below the last contract. Project Fraax slips by six weeks because of the tooling delay.

## Deployment: Deep-link Router

The Wayfinch deep-link router maps inbound app links to screens in the Nimblecart mobile client. Deploy via the standard pipeline; no manual steps. Contractors: do not change routing rules in production directly — edit the manifest and redeploy. Stale link caches clear within five minutes. The router reads the following configuration at startup, reproduced below.

config for haweg-bagag:
[kasath]
host = kasath.qirvancorp.internal
user = kasath_svc
database = kasath_prod

# Hollowmark Environments: Dependency Pinning

All Hollowmark environments pin exact dependency versions. No ranges, no wildcards. Staging may trial new pins for one sprint; production only accepts pins that passed a full staging cycle. Emergency unpins require release-manager sign-off and must be re-pinned within 48 hours. The lockfile is the source of truth; the manifest is advisory. Audit runs nightly and flags drift. Current pinned environment configuration values follow below.

config for bagep-kageg:
ULADOR_LOG_LEVEL=warn
ULADOR_METRICS_HOST=metrics.ulador.tolvaqcorp.corp
ULADOR_POOL_SIZE=32